Wilayats celebrate mass weddings with song and dance; Suwaiq tops

The Sultanate recently witnessed several mass weddings across governorates, most of which were organised by social groups with support from private institutions.


Besides reflecting the solidarity and interdependence in Omani society, mass weddings also bring down the cost of marriages. Dancing and singing were part of most of the weddings.


The wilayat of Al Khabourah saw 99 weddings, followed by Suwaiq (90), Ibri (76), Saham (69), Liwa (50), Izki (47), Suhar (41), Shinas (20,) Al Buraimi (44), Jaalan Bu Ali (38), Manah (30), Bahla (25), Barket Almooz (28) and Nizwa (22).


A mass wedding was held in the Wilayat of Saham under the patronage of Sheikh Mohammed bin Saeed al Kalbani, Minister of Social Development. The event, which saw 69 couples entering wedlock, was the fifth mass wedding organised in the wilayat. This time, it was held with support from Badi Investment Holding. Shaikh Ali Ibn Mansour al Busaidi, the Wali of Saham, and a number of officials graced the occasion. The organising committee had been preparing and coordinating for the last four months for the fifth mass wedding. A total of 170 volunteers were part of different groups in the committee, which included the main group, reception group, hospitality group, coordination group and media group.


The celebration area was provided with air-conditioning, which was very essential because of high temperatures at this time of year.


Rich cultural programmes were presented by the people of Saham who showcased the art of Razha, Shalla, Ayyala.
